    Default Re: AIBA World Cup, Moscow

    Excited obviously to see Lomachenko and Banteaux again. Anytime the Cubans and Russians send full squads anywhere it's going to be a tournament worth watching.

    Don't know how the ditching of the team format is going to work out I think only one American is making the trip, Michael Hunter who didn't qualify for Beijing. Saw the seeding earlier this week and there a lot of names that I've never seen before seeded at the top of their bracket.
